What is recorded here

Four houses clustered in Cloonbonniff when surveyed in 1701, perhaps belonging to one extended family or neighbouring tenants sharing a field. This record refers a cluster of four houses shown in Cloonbonniff townland on a 1701 Trustees Survey map (NLI microfilm, no. 645, p. 31). The precise location of the houses is unknown. Compiled by: Jane O'Shaughnessy Date of upload: 17 February 2023
